Default Loaded update.zip froyo - will i get ota update?

Does manually loading 2.2 before ota pushed, prevent receipt of "official" 2.2 ota update?

Depends. If you manually loaded FRG01B then yes you should not receive the current OTA (which is also FRG01B).

If you pushed FRG22, then you'll get notifications for the current FRG01B.
